This function is meant as an internal routine for graph visualization with a force-directed layout procedure.
However, it can be used to set the coordinate system with the coord option in functions multigraph and in bmgraph.
In such case, the coordinate system of the graph starts with a random displacement of nodes where NULL in the seed argument implies
an initial seed based on the computer clock watch, and the number of iterations in maxiter is 60+n.
A data frame with a coordinated system with two columns representing the abscissa and the ordinate in a two-dimensional rectangular Cartesian coordinate system.
